Fresh from The Great Escape, and supporting Nadine Shah, Claudia Fenoglio is a Leeds based singer-songwriter making indie-pop music, blending intimate and ethereal sounds with poignant storytelling. Look a little closer, and Fenoglio is revolutionising the indie-pop genre as we know it. Whether in her bedroom or in the studio, Claudia Fenoglio is an artist who isn’t afraid to challenge herself and her listeners, creating timeless, boundary-pushing pop music along the way. 

With new EP It Always Fades In The End, Fenoglio conjures a cinematic, poignant tapestry of songs that navigate the complexities of queer relationships. An EP that at its core is “about learning to let go and all the steps in between”, Fenoglio fuses shimmering pop flourishes with earnest lyricism that confronts the emotional weight of impermanence and the human impulse to cling onto what’s inevitably slipping away. Yet, where there is uncertainty there is also resilience. “While a lot of the songs stick to the idea that nothing good lasts forever,” Fenoglio explains, “there are also a few that bring a bit of hope - showing that love, in all its forms, can survive even when life gets hard.”
